  10. What's up people? I just wanted to post what I am listening to, since it was brought up. By the way, I like all type of music, but I really like good Big production House mixes. I recommend all of you to get the new Johnny Vicious cd called Ultra Dance 01. It's really great, I got mine at Virgin for 15.99 and it's a double CD. The first disk has alot of vocals but still good ones. My personal favorites if anyone has heard it, and you should is by Aubrey "Stand Still". And there is a new one on it called "Something" by Lasgo. That song is going to be big. Anyways, the second disc is all hard Trance. Very typical of Johnny Vicious. Trust me, you will all like it. Here are some other tracks you can download that are pretty cool in MY opinion. "The Heartbreak" by Friburn & Urik (very cool hard house) "No more Drama(Danny Morris Mix)" Mary J. Blige (if you like the original and wanna hear a good tribal mix to it, get this.) "Break 4 Love(Friburn & Urik Mix)" Pet Shop Boys ( another hard house mix of this song) "Feel The Beat (Robbie Rivera Tribal Sessions Mix)" by Darude (its an old song, but this is a new Tribal mix to this song, nice and dark) "Wake Up (Guido mix or Johnny Vicious) by Beki (This song is the SHIT, get either mix, my fav is the Guido Mix, trust me) Sorry if this is too long, but just wanted to share with you some mixes that you might not have heard but hopefully will like. Tell me what you think. If you have another questions, drop me a line. laters Sam
